Eskom nuke plan will raise electricity costs

Eskom has expanded its nuclear programme with a revised plan of study to build nuclear power stations at Duynefontein, Bantamsklip and Thyspunt.

It seems very coincidental that Eskom's nuclear multiplication plans go hand in glove with a demand for a 34 percent price hike for electricity.

The majority of people in South Africa simply will not be able to afford to live because of the domino effect that increases in electricity will mean. Once again this shows that nuclear energy is the most expensive form of energy on the planet.

People have until June 23 to respond to this revised plan of study. It is on Eskom's website at www.eskom.co.za/eia under the Nuclear 1 link.

Ingela Richardson, Gonubie
